Mitutoyo: Varifocal Lens Taglens

Taglens is a liquid lens whose basic principle is based on optical imaging by the grin effect (gradient in the refractive index). The unique feature of this technology is that, unlike grin glass lenses, the gradient in the liquid is not static, but is modulated by means of piezo elements at a frequency of 70 kilohertz. As a result, the focus of an optical system incorporating Taglens is scanned far beyond the depth-of-field range limited by conventional optics, 70,000 times per second. This means that a depth-of-field range extended by up to 20 times is imaged without mechanically moving components.
